Understanding Overclocking And Its Effects

Overclocking is a popular practice among PC enthusiasts that involves increasing the clock speed of a computer’s central processing unit (CPU) beyond its official specifications. By doing so, users aim to achieve higher performance and faster processing speeds. However, it is essential to understand the potential risks and drawbacks associated with this practice before delving into it.

What Is Overclocking And Why Is It Done?

Overclocking is the process of pushing the CPU’s clock speed beyond its default settings. The clock speed determines how fast the CPU can execute instructions. By increasing the clock speed, users can achieve improved performance for tasks that heavily rely on CPU processing power, such as gaming, video editing, and rendering.

Overclocking is primarily done to extract more power from the CPU and enhance overall system performance. It allows users to maximize the potential of their hardware without the need for expensive upgrades.

The Potential Risks And Drawbacks Of Overclocking

While overclocking may seem appealing for its performance benefits, it comes with potential risks and drawbacks that users should be aware of:

  • Increased heat: Overclocking raises the CPU’s operating frequency, leading to increased heat generation. This can put additional stress on the CPU and require better cooling solutions to prevent overheating.
  • Reduced CPU lifespan: Running a CPU at higher frequencies for extended periods can decrease its lifespan. The increased voltage and heat can cause degradation over time, resulting in a shorter lifespan for the CPU.
  • Potential instability: Pushing a CPU beyond its intended specifications can lead to system instability. This can result in crashes, application errors, and unexpected behavior, potentially causing data loss or system damage.

How Overclocking Affects The Cpu Performance

When a CPU is overclocked, its clock speed is increased, allowing it to execute instructions at a faster rate. This results in improved processing power and faster performance for CPU-intensive tasks. However, the extent of performance improvement varies depending on the CPU model, cooling solutions, and the efficiency of the overall system.

It’s important to note that the performance boost gained from overclocking is not a linear progression. As the clock speed increases, the CPU’s power requirements and heat output also rise exponentially. At a certain point, the benefits of overclocking start diminishing, and the risks outweigh the performance gains.

Before attempting to overclock your CPU, it is crucial to thoroughly research your specific CPU model, understand the limitations and potential risks, and ensure proper cooling measures are in place. Additionally, it is necessary to have a stable and efficient power supply to support the increased power demands of an overclocked CPU.

Different Methods To Reset Overclock Cpu

When it comes to resetting a CPU’s overclock settings, there are a few different methods you can use. Each method is designed to restore your BIOS/UEFI settings to their default values and clear any errors or conflicts that may be causing issues with your system. In this section, we will explore four different methods you can try:

Resetting The Bios/uefi Settings To Default

To reset your BIOS/UEFI settings to default, you can either use the BIOS/UEFI menu or a specific key combination during startup. Here’s how:

  1. Turn on or restart your computer.
  2. During startup, look for a message that instructs you to press a specific key (such as F2 or Del) to enter the BIOS/UEFI menu.
  3. Once inside the menu, look for an option to reset the settings to default or load default values.
  4. Select this option and confirm your choice.
  5. Save the changes and exit the BIOS/UEFI menu. Your system will restart with the default settings applied.

Clearing The Cmos Using A Jumper Or Button

If resetting the BIOS/UEFI settings didn’t work, you can try clearing the CMOS using a jumper or button on your motherboard. Here’s how:

  1. Ensure your computer is turned off and unplugged from the power source.
  2. Locate the CMOS jumper or button on your motherboard. It is usually labeled “CLR CMOS,” “RESET CMOS,” or something similar.
  3. Move the jumper to the clear position or press the button (refer to your motherboard manual for specific instructions).
  4. Wait for a few seconds, then move the jumper back to its original position or release the button.
  5. Plug in your computer and turn it on. The CMOS should now be cleared, resetting the overclock settings.

Removing And Reinserting The Cmos Battery

If clearing the CMOS via jumper or button is not an option, you can try removing and reinserting the CMOS battery. Here’s how:

  1. Turn off your computer and unplug it from the power source.
  2. Open your computer case to access the motherboard.
  3. Locate the CMOS battery on the motherboard. It is usually a small round battery.
  4. Carefully remove the battery from its slot.
  5. Wait for a few minutes, then reinsert the battery back into its slot.
  6. Close the computer case, plug in your computer, and turn it on. The CMOS should now be reset.

Using Software Utilities To Reset Overclock Settings

If the previous methods didn’t work, you can try using software utilities specifically designed to reset overclock settings. These utilities can be downloaded and installed on your computer. Here’s how:

  1. Search for a reputable software utility that supports your motherboard model and CPU.
  2. Download and install the software on your computer.
  3. Launch the software and look for an option to reset overclock settings.
  4. Select this option and follow any further instructions provided by the software.
  5. Once the reset is complete, restart your computer for the changes to take effect.

These are the different methods you can use to reset your CPU’s overclock settings. Depending on your specific situation, one method may be more suitable than the others. If one method doesn’t work, feel free to try another until you are able to successfully reset your overclock settings.

Step-by-step Guide To Reset Overclock Cpu Using Bios/uefi Settings

Learn how to reset the overclock CPU settings using BIOS/UEFI with a step-by-step guide. Easily restore your CPU to default settings and resolve any errors or conflicts that may arise.

Step-by-Step Guide to Reset Overclock CPU using BIOS/UEFI Settings

How To Access The Bios/uefi Menu

To reset your overclock settings, you need to access the BIOS (Basic Input/Output System) or UEFI (Unified Extensible Firmware Interface) menu on your computer. Follow these steps:

  1. Restart your computer.
  2. During the boot process, press the designated key (usually Del, F2, or Esc) to enter the BIOS/UEFI menu. The specific key may vary depending on your motherboard manufacturer.
  3. You will see a BIOS/UEFI menu screen.

Locating And Resetting The Overclocking Settings To Default

Once you are in the BIOS/UEFI menu, you need to locate the overclocking settings and reset them to default. Here’s how:

  1. Navigate to the “Advanced” or “Overclocking” section in the BIOS/UEFI menu.
  2. Look for options related to CPU overclocking, such as “CPU Ratio”, “Base Clock”, or “Multiplier”.
  3. Set these options back to their default values. You may need to refer to your motherboard’s manual or manufacturer’s website for the specific default values.
  4. Save the changes to reset the overclocking settings to default.

Saving Changes And Exiting The Bios/uefi Menu

After resetting the overclocking settings, you need to save the changes and exit the BIOS/UEFI menu. Follow these steps:

  1. Navigate to the “Exit” or “Save & Exit” section in the BIOS/UEFI menu.
  2. Select the option to save the changes and exit the menu.
  3. Your computer will reboot with the overclocking settings reset to default.

By following these simple steps, you can easily reset the overclocking settings of your CPU using the BIOS/UEFI menu. Remember to consult your motherboard’s manual or manufacturer’s website for specific instructions related to your system.
